I found MC to be smooth, but it seems to pan out after the last loop IMO, there's nothing but a market and a few twists!

I've never ridden JO to comment, but I've heard it's not the smoothest coaster ever built. I believe it was built to be a smooth ride, as they'd made the gap between the wheels and track smaller, however this caused greater friction and made the car stall.

Origianally the Hammerhead Stall was put back to 2005 as Vekoma said they needed to do more testing on it, Last I heard they actually had it built on their own test ground. But shortly after it was dismantled and no-one has heard anything since?
